Mark Warburton's first words as ex-Brentford and Rangers boss accepts QPR role

QPR have announced the appointment of Mark Warburton as the club's new manager.

The former Brentford and Rangers boss has been handed a 2-year deal and takes over from Steve McClaren who was sacked at the beginning of April.

56-year-old was last in charge of Nottingham Forest in 2017 but was dismissed with the side in 14th place on New Year's Eve and has been without a management role since.

Warburton noted that the plan that the Rs have in place was part of what convinced him to join the club.

He said: “I am delighted and privileged to be managing this club.

“When I spoke to QPR they were very clear. They have a solid plan and know what they want. They have a long-term outlook and that appealed to me immediately.

“I am excited about the challenge that lies ahead.”

The new boss also revealed a little about what we can expect tactically from the west London team moving forward.

He said: “I love seeing players who enjoy their football.

“I like players being brave in possession, understanding the first thought is to play forward and be positive.

“You have to be fit as well. Work ethic, desire, hunger, passion – all those clichés are so important for us.

“Get that right and fingers crossed we will move in the right direction.”
